I'm trying to update my K750i is driving me nuts!

I've been onto the SEUS, followed all the instructions, downloaded everything it says to, but when it says to unplug the usb cable, and turn it back on holding down the C key, nothing happens, my phone just turns on as normal. I've read on this forum that the phone isn't supposed to switch on?

The only thing i can think of is to do with the USB drivers that the SEUS tells you to download. The installation instructions that it gives says that the hardware wizard will start 5 times, but it doesn't.

I have tried uninstalling the drivers from the device manager and then plugging in the USB cable, but XP automatically installs the drivers, without bringing up the 'Add Hardware Wizard'. I have also tried updating the drivers through device manager but that don't work either.

have open the device manager in windows (window key+ pause/break key, click on the hardware tab, then click on the device manager button). turn off the phone and unplug the usb cable and wait about 20/30 seconds. hold down c and plug in the usb cable and the device manager should show a yellow ! icon next to a device called usb flash. click on the usb flash and install the seus driver, and it should now work
